Hypoallergenic Dog Breeds
There is no such thing as a dog that is 100% hypoallergenic. This phrase refers to dogs that are low allergy. These dogs can be a form of relief for individuals who love to have canine companions, but cannot deal with their allergy attacks in the presence of dogs. Hypoallergenic dogs shed little to no hair. Further, they do not produce as much dander as the average dog. All dogs, even hairless ones, shed dander, but these ones have a low level of it. The most hypoallergenic dogs are the ones that have no hair or continuous hair growth. Some people are allergic to dog saliva. Unfortunately, no dog breed comes with hypoallergenic saliva. The phrase only refers to hair and dander when it comes to canine breeds. People with severe allergies, however, may still have reactions to hypoallergenic dogs.
